I'm not doing anything to compensate for them, so I guess you could say that I'm not keeping them any cooler than the air pumping underneath them. B, H, K motors all use them in one form or another. You will find many people who have taken them out of non-f motors with no problem.

I'm sure that you could modify the squirters if you really wanted to, maybe shortening the nozzle or altering the direction of the nozzle to prevent it from being hit by a rod, I simply didn't want to.

tracked s2k's run their oil temps up to 260 degrees. That's why oil squirters are so important. If you plan to run your car like that an oil cooler will keep everything safe. Oil squirters are more variable in your motor. Endyn doesn't use them in any built motors.
